The Phoenix are down, but certainly not out if head coach Mike Kelly has anything to say about it.
Despite a 1-3 record to begin NBL24, it’s not all doom and gloom for the incumbent coach who has been dealt roster blow after roster blow.
"It's frustrating with a group I think has the talent to be very good in this league,” Kelly said post-match.
“At the same time, I just look forward to having everybody back and building and learning from each game.”

Kelly hasn’t yet had either Alan Williams or Gorjok Gak take the court in season proper, and injury replacement and NBL Blitz MVP Tyler Cook also missed the Hawks clash with an eye abrasion.
South East Melbourne stunned title-hopefuls Perth in their second hit-out, getting out to as much as a 30-point lead at the Fire Pit, but while a fire was lit under the Phoenix, it was somewhat doused after road trip losses to both Cairns and Illawarra.
But despite losses, Kelly is imploring his brigade to stand tall and stay together.
"I want people to think our guys play hard and they're brave, and they play for each other.”
"Great effort doesn't always do it; it's got to be great effort and playing really smart at the same time."
The Phoenix have a full week to recover and prepare themselves before their round three game against the Tasmania JackJumpers, who are currently 2-1, at the Fire Pit on Saturday night.
